WECA is a nonprofit organization serving merit shop electrical contractors, their employees and the industry suppliers that support them. In California, WECA offers federal and state-approved Commercial, Residential, and Low Voltage (Voice Data Video and Fire Life Safety) Electrical Apprenticeship programs, a state-approved Electrician Trainee program, certification exam preparation classes, and state-approved continuing education classes for journeyperson electricians and low voltage technicians. In Arizona, WECA offers a federal and state-approved Commercial Electrical Apprenticeship program and continuing education classes for Journeyperson electricians. In Utah, WECA offers a federal and state-approved Commercial Electrical Apprenticeship program. WECA additionally shares its expertise by producing curriculum products and publications for the industry. Job Summary:This role works on curriculum development, updates, maintenance, and continuing improvement for WECA’s Electrician Trainee and Continuing Education programs, including the GetWired! online training program for Electrician Trainees. Acts as subject matter expert in electrical construction standards and practices. Under the guidance of Curriculum Development and Get Wired Training Manager: Works with curriculum development team members, instructors, and other subject matter experts to develop online self-paced, instructor-led online, and classroom/lab-based learning experiences. Regular responsibility for updating curriculum across multiple product and service lines to remain current with relevant codes and standards and meet regular product life cycle deadlines. Utilizes instructional design and adult learning theory. Formulates learning objectives, recommends and selects appropriate methods and media, develops presentation content, develops learning assessments, and continuously evaluates training effectiveness in close consultation with team. Transforms technical content into logically sequenced, interactive, and engaging learning activities. Participates in the testing, evaluation, and implementation of cutting-edge learning technologies including online interactive simulation development, AI for learning, and extended reality (XR, AR, VR). Contributes expertise to new education product development launches and internal product training. Participates with the curriculum, instructional, and online training delivery teams on related projects as assigned. This position is remote work-eligible, with expectation of occasional onsite presence as needed. Candidates can also choose an onsite or hybrid arrangement if they prefer, based out of any of WECA's California training facilities (Rancho Cordova/Sacramento Region, Fresno, Riverside, or San Diego).
